Position Summary:

The Senior Research Administrator (Senior RA) plays a key role in supporting faculty and investigators within the Division of Molecular and Cellular Oncology. This role focuses heavily on pre-award activities , particularly supporting early-career investigators with grant submissions, while also managing post-award activities to ensure compliance and financial oversight.

The Senior RA manages a diverse research funding portfolio (federal, industry, foundation, donor, institutional, chargeback, and clinical trials) and serves as a trusted partner to faculty, investigators, and department leadership. This position requires strong communication skills, the ability to explain processes clearly, and the expertise to guide investigators through the full research administration life cycle.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age all administrative aspects of grant preparation and submission for sponsored research applications.
  • Guide investigators (especially early-career faculty) through proposal requirements and deadlines.
  • Draft non-scientific sections, coordinate with collaborators across departments/institutions, and ensure compliance with institutional and sponsor requirements.
  • Research funding opportunities and support Just-In-Time (JIT) submissions.
  • Oversee financial management of awarded grants and institutional funds.
  • Provide projections and financial reports to investigators, ensuring adherence to budgets, sponsor, and institutional policies.
  • Manage industry agreements, including tracking milestones, receivables, and clinical trial billing.
  • Approve and process procurement requests, ensuring expenses are allowable and appropriately allocated.
  • Partner with leadership and faculty on HR processes, including job postings, hiring analyses, and salary allocations.
  • Serve as a senior resource within the business office, mentoring colleagues and contributing to training initiatives.

Qualifications:

  • 2–4+ years of direct grant administration experience
  • Solid understanding of the full grant life cycle , especially post-award management.
  • Experience working in research administration within scientific departments, research institutes, or higher education.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to clearly explain financial and administrative processes to faculty and staff.
  • Ability to work independently, manage multiple deadlines, and problem-solve effectively.
